C1 Fund Portfolio Company BitGo Successfully Lists on NYSE, Marking Fund's First Exit Less Than Six Months After IPO.

Wednesday, Jan 28, 2026 4:25 am ET1min read
CFND--

C1 Fund, a finance company, announced the successful IPO of its portfolio company BitGo, a leading provider of institutional digital asset custody and infrastructure services. This marks C1 Fund's first portfolio company exit less than six months after the fund's own IPO. BitGo raised $212.8 million in its IPO and has a valuation exceeding $2 billion. C1 Fund invested $30 million in BitGo and focuses on late-stage private companies that enable institutional adoption of digital assets.
